The problem is most probably you access HA via SSL but the iFrame is set for non ssl http. The docs explicitly say you can’t do that. If you use ssl for HA you need to use it for configurator iFrame as well. You would then also need to forward port 3218 on your router.

You should be able to use http://ip-address:3218 in a different browser window - not an iFrame.

Did you have a look at the log of the addon? I’m fairly confident it will tell you, that the client IP is not within the allowed networks.
